I ordered mine from www.lik-sang. com I ordered it on a Monday and it arrived the following Monday. It is Jap/US modified, by way of a simple switch and has given me no problems with Monkey Ball or Rogue Leader. I was a little aprehensive as it is the first time I have imported a console but everything went without a hitch. www.lik-sang.com are selling them for 182.62 UK pounds and that includes a step down transformer. Delivery cost 34.55 but can be cheaper if you are prepared to wait longer. The only other thing to watch out for is the import duty, got smacked for 60.42, ouch!! That was for the console and Rogue Leader. I would guess that just the console would drop that a little, can let you know in a couple of days when my friends one turns up!
One thing worth bearing in mind is that there may be delays in getting one from dvdboxoffice. I originally placed an order there a few months back. Nearer the release I got a mail saying that they would not be getting enough units to satisfy pre orders, that was when I switched to lik-sang. My friend has an order with boxoffice, which he placed a couple of weeks after me and this has not been sent yet, hence he switched to lik-sang also. although he has recieved Rogue Leader and Monkey Ball. He has had a week with games and no console, it's too funny for words.
Regarding the previous post about getting it and it not working, that is also something worth bearing in mind and is something I was fearful of. But also bear in mind the case of one of my other mates who got a UK PS2 which didn't work out of the box, he had to wait a few weeks for another one. Yes it is less of a problem if it is a UK model but it can still happen.
So long as you have a TV that can accept an NTSC signal, there shouldn't be any problems just don't forget the stepdown! Also don't forget that it won't be here until March at the earliest and some sources are even quoting the summer or autumn!
